JavaScript 是一种广泛使用的脚本语言,主要用于网页开发,增强网页的交互性。MySQL 是一个关系型数据库管理系统,用于存储和管理数据。JavaScript 通常与 MySQL 结合使用,通过服务器端脚本(如 Node.js)来连接和操作 MySQL 数据库。
解决方案:
mysql
或 mysql2
。const mysql = require('mysql');
const connection = mysql.createConnection({
host: 'localhost',
user: 'user',
password: 'password',
database: 'database_name'
});
connection.connect((err) => {
if (err) throw err;
console.log('Connected to MySQL database!');
});
解决方案:
connection.query('SELECT * FROM table_name', (err, results, fields) => {
if (err) throw err;
console.log(results);
});
解决方案:
connection.on('error', (err) => {
console.error('Database connection error:', err);
if (err.code === 'PROTOCOL_CONNECTION_LOST') {
console.error('Database connection was closed.');
}
if (err.code === 'ER_CON_COUNT_ERROR') {
console.error('Database has too many connections.');
}
if (err.code === 'ECONNREFUSED') {
console.error('Database connection was refused.');
}
});
通过以上信息,你可以了解 JavaScript 和 MySQL 的基础概念、优势、类型、应用场景以及常见问题的解决方案。希望这些信息对你有所帮助!
领取专属 10元无门槛券
手把手带您无忧上云